**Responsibilities**:
**An excellent opportunity has arisen for an enthusiastic, motivated individual to join our Organisational Development team on a fixed term contract, providing career break cover, until 31**st** March 2026.**
This role offers significant variety, opportunity and challenge across a range of wellbeing, benefits and engagement activities including:
- coordinating projects relating to Wellbeing, Benefits and Engagement,
- coordinating the Colleague Peer-to-Peer Support Networks (menopause, carers men’s health)
- delivering new starter Inductions and new starter pastoral support
- coordinating and implementing the delivery of colleague recognition including standing ovation awards and long service awards
- supporting organisational approaches to increasing and measuring staff engagement; including colleague surveys, newsletters, listening events and focus groups.
This role requires a person who has excellent organisational and analytical skills combined with the ability to network, influence and carry out activities to provide wellbeing and benefits support and engagement to colleagues across Locala.
